1. Analyze the Water Meter
Every house has a water meter. Examining it is a proven manner in which aids you discover leaks. For starters, shut off all the water sources. Guarantee no one will purge, utilize the tap, shower, run the cleaning maker or dishwashing machine. From there, go to the meter and also watch if it will certainly alter. Given that no person is using it, there must be no activities. That indicates a fast-moving leak if it relocates. Likewise, if you detect no changes, wait an hour or more as well as examine back again. This suggests you might have a slow-moving leak that might even be underground.
2. Inspect Water Usage
If you spot unexpected adjustments, regardless of your usage being the exact same, it means that you have leaks in your plumbing system. An unexpected spike in your expense suggests a fast-moving leakage.
On the other hand, a constant rise each month, despite having the very same practices, reveals you have a sluggish leakage that's likewise slowly escalating. Call a plumber to thoroughly examine your property, specifically if you feel a cozy location on your floor with piping underneath.

4. Asses Exterior Lines
Do not neglect to check your outdoor water lines as well. Should water leak out of the link, you have a loosened rubber gasket. One small leak can waste bunches of water as well as increase your water expense.
5. Assess the situation and also inspect
House owners need to make it a habit to check under the sink counters and even inside cabinets for any type of bad odor or mold development. These 2 warnings indicate a leakage so timely attention is called for. Doing regular examinations, even bi-annually, can save you from a significant problem.
Much more importantly, if you know your house is already old, keep a watchful eye on your heating units, pipes, pipelines etc. Check for stainings as well as damaging as most pipelines and appliances have a life span. They will likewise normally weaken because of tear and also wear. Do not wait for it to rise if you believe dripping water lines in your plumbing system. Top 4 Signs of a Plumbing Leak in Your Home
Unusually High Utility Bills
As someone who regularly pays your water and energy bills, you know when something is a little off. If you are utility bills are higher than usual, or have seen a sudden spike in cost, it could be an indication that you have a hidden plumbing leak somewhere in your system. First, contact your utility company to confirm that your bill is correct, and if it is, your next step is to contact in licensed plumber for a home plumbing inspection in Indianapolis.
Leaky Plumbing Fixtures
Take a closer look at your plumbing fixtures that dispense water, such as your bathroom and kitchen sink faucets, your shower heads, and even your outdoor spigots. If they are leaky, even when turned off (don’t forget the old saying, “lefty-loosey righty-tighty” to be sure), it could be that you have a leak somewhere in your plumbing system. This type of concealed leak is the exact kind that can get worse, fast; so, it is important that you immediately contact in Indianapolis plumbing company for emergency plumbing repair.
Dying Patches of Grass in the Lawn
You wouldn’t immediately think that poor lawn quality could indicate hidden plumbing leak in your house or building, but it actually can. Noticing large spots of dead or dying grass in your lawn is indicative of an underground plumbing pipe leak. This could be caused by a pipe rupture, cracked sewage lines, pipe burst, or even a poorly sealed gasket or connecting hardware. Oftentimes, property owners also notice puddles of standing water in their lawn, which is a sign of an emergency water leak plumbing repair.
Running Water Meter Dial
A common way for homeowners to check if they have a concealed water leak within the plumbing system is to examine the water meter dial. To do so, take a pen and paper out to your water meter and write down the number the dial is pointing to. Wait 20 to 30 minutes, and then go back to see if the dial has moved. If the dial continues to move, it is indicative of a plumbing leak. In this case you should contact in Indianapolis master plumber right away.
